Dark Chocolate Pistachio Blondie
Blondies have a similar flavor to chocolate chip cookies without having to individually portion each cookie. I am a big fan of the dark chocolate/pistachio combo.
Dark Chocolate Pistachio Blondie
1/2 cup salted butter, melted
1 cup dark brown sugar
1 large egg
1/2 teaspoon baking powder
1/8 teaspoon baking soda
1/2 teaspoon salt
1 cup all-purpose flour
1 cup dark chocolate chips
1/2 cup pistachios, chopped
flaky sea salt (optional)
In a medium sized mixing bowl, whisk melted butter and brown sugar. Add the egg and stir until completely combined.
Add baking powder, soda, salt, and flour. Use a spatula to stir until combined. Add dark chocolate chips and chopped pistachios, stir until combined.
Spread into a parchment lined and greased 8 inch square pan.
Bake at 350 degrees for 20-25 minutes or until the center is set and the blondies are golden brown. Sprinkle with flaky sea salt if desired.
Cool completely. Cut into squares. Serve. Store leftovers in an airtight container.
